A Blue Christmas service is a time of worship and reflection for those who are navigating grief, experiencing loneliness during the holiday season, or who may be experiencing any sort of difficult circumstance.

At First Methodist, our Blue Christmas service is a casual time of worship, so come as you are — dressing up is not required. Parking is available on the east side (look for Happy State Bank) of our building, and you may enter through the east doors under the red awning. The service will have a time of worship through song, a brief message, reading of Scripture, and a time of personal prayer. This is a peaceful, reflective time that we invite you to enjoy and partake in as you feel led.

You do not have to be a member of First Methodist Church to attend this service. All are invited who are in need of hope this Christmas season.
